Metro 400mg BD 5/7. Alternative: metro 0.75% vaginal gel nocte 5/7 OR clindamycin 2% vaginal cream 5g applicator PV nocte for 7/7. Pregnant/BF: routine rx not recommended if asymptomatic.
BV in pregnancy associated with preterm birth and impaired perinatal outcomes. Although treatment reduced bacterial overgrowth, it did not significantly reduce the risk of preterm births. Conclusion: little evidence that screening and treating all pregnant women with BV will prevent preterm births and its consequences. Antibiotics for treating bacterial vaginosis in pregnancy.
